Little Witch Academia 2-6

The Netflix release is perfect for my current viewing habits; I can watch this dubbed while I wander around doing other things because it doesn't really require much attention. They missed a trick by not giving the British characters British accents, particularly as the whole show is set in Britain...

While it's nice to watch something that has basically nothing objectionable about it at all (a rarity in modern anime!), I'd also be hard-pressed to say it's very exciting, either; while, as with the OVAs, it's clearly aiming for the Harry Potter milieu, it doesn't really hit the same sweet spot. Akko is far less irritating in English than in Japanese, but it doesn't alter the fact that, as always for shows of this ilk, she's going to spend huge amounts of time being completely useless at everything because that's apparently how character development works for anime. Diana essentially steals focus every time she appears on screen and actually has dimensions of characterisation.

Some lovely effects animation, though.

Anyway, the real reason to post about this is to correct bad Latin in episode 6.


The sign above says something like "Oh sleeping one
although "sleeping" is spelt wrong
of Arka, do not wake (something) up. If you approach the fountain, you will attack, oh Arka of the Polaris guard!". It's basically nonsense - poor vocab choices and silly grammar mistakes. I'd probably say something like "nolite Arkam dormientem excitare; si fonti appropinquabitis, Arka, custos Polaris, vos oppugnabit."
